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88339 38639901 716063435 955828733
9468210924 60431964 8522833417
9468210924 60431964 8522833417
4756766 37952918598 4375587 98
All about undefined
Interested in learning more?
9468210924 60431964 8522833417
4756766 37952918598 4375587 98
See more
03007 5226
3893641 886231194 098742
See more
0421052118 82591068947 6829
90777167555 018 76575278
See more